Eye Treatment Lipid Oil is an oil-type eye care product used around the eyes after face cleansing. It spreads lightly without stickiness and leaves a bouncy, conditioned feel when tapped with fingertips. When the eye area feels dry and dull, it provides comfortable care before the next step.
